Position Overview

Graybar, an employee-owned company, is hiring Warehouse Associates to support daily operations in a fast-paced distribution environment. This role involves receiving, stocking, picking, and shipping materials for electrical contractors.

Key Responsibilities

  • Receive, stock, and organize incoming materials

  • Break down and sort products for storage or shipment

  • Pick, pack, and stage orders accurately

  • Operate RF scanners to fulfill orders

  • Move materials to racks and designated locations

  • Perform wire cutting using machine-based equipment

  • Maintain quality and accuracy by double-checking work

  • Keep a clean and safe work environment

Departments / Work Areas

  • Receiving / Putaway (Sam’s Crew): Unloading, sorting, and stocking materials

  • Wire Cutting: Measuring and cutting wire per order specifications

  • Outbound (Shipping): Picking, packing, and preparing shipments
